Challenge in the surgical management of PE
tumour lies in its deep-seated location
behind the manubrium bone (M) in close
proximity to great vessels in the lower neck
and superior mediastinum.
Scarring from previous surgery and/or
radiotherapy further increases the
complexity of surgery.
Last but not least, many of these patients are
nutritionally deprived with poor lung
function. This in turn increases operative
risks.
